ABSTRACT
The inflammasome is a kind of multi-protein complexes with high molecular weight that can induce cells to die under the pathological conditions of inflammation and stress.After spinal cord injury,there are a variety of immune cells with different functions in the local injured microenvironment.Under natural conditions,the immune cell subsets in the local injured microenvironment are imbalance in"yin and yang",and the destructive subpopulations and cytokines are dominant.This is an important mechanism of pathological damage caused by SCI.Inflammasome plays an extremely important role in the process of central nervous system injury.Although activation of inflammasome and IL-1β and IL-18 are all expressed at the site of injured spinal cords,their effects on local immune microenvironment of SCI have not yet been reported.According to the current research progress,we believe that activation of inflammasome can affect the local immune microenvironment of SCI.This is an interesting topic,but few related studies have been re-ported.This review focuses on four types of inflammasomes associated with CNS injury.Their structure,function and so on will be ex-pounded.The relationship between inflammasome activation and immune microenvironment of SCI will also be discussed.
